One of the biggest reasons multiplayer games create strong social connections is the need for teamwork. Many online games require players to cooperate in order to achieve common objectives. Whether completing missions, winning matches, or overcoming powerful enemies, success often depends on communication and collaboration. These shared goals encourage players to work together and develop trust over time.
Communication is another major factor that strengthens relationships in multiplayer gaming. Voice chat, text messaging, and in-game communication systems allow players to interact constantly during gameplay. These conversations often extend beyond the game itself, leading to discussions about hobbies, careers, education, and daily life. Over time, gaming partners frequently become genuine friends.
Shared experiences also contribute to stronger social bonds. Players who spend hours exploring virtual worlds together create memories that can last for years. Victories, challenges, unexpected events, and exciting moments become stories that friends continue to discuss long after they happen. These experiences help establish emotional connections similar to those formed through traditional social activities.
Online gaming communities provide a sense of belonging that many players value. Guilds, clans, and teams offer structured environments where individuals can connect with people who share similar interests. For some players, these communities become important social circles where they feel accepted and supported. This sense of belonging encourages long-term participation and deeper relationships.
Multiplayer games also eliminate geographical barriers. Players can interact with individuals from different countries, cultures, and backgrounds without leaving their homes. These interactions expose players to diverse perspectives and create opportunities for friendships that would otherwise be impossible. As a result, gaming has become a powerful tool for connecting people worldwide.
The rise of live-service games has further strengthened social engagement. Regular updates, seasonal events, and community activities give players reasons to return and interact frequently. These ongoing experiences help maintain friendships and keep gaming communities active throughout the year.
